## Undo/Redo — Draftloom Diagram Editor

Undo stack is command-based, capped at 200 entries per canvas. Redo clears on any new mutation. Known risk: collaborative sessions can desync the stack if ops arrive out of order; affected users see "history unavailable." Before release, run the history-replay suite and check the desync counter on the metrics board. Do not ship if desyncs exceed baseline. Full verification checklist is on the internal release page.

runbook for badug-kadup: https://confluence.zemvarlabs.internal/projects/browse/display/projects/bd1b

// Notes for the weekly eng sync re: Gallerywhisper, our museum audio-guide app.
// This constant sets the prefetch radius for exhibit audio clips. At the
// Hollen Pavilion pilot we learned visitors walk faster than our original
// estimate, so clips were buffering mid-stride. Bumping this to three rooms
// ahead fixed it, at a modest bandwidth cost. Don't lower it without testing
// on the slow gallery wifi first — seriously, it's painful. The trace token
// from the pilot build that validated this number is appended just below.

trace token, kahap-bagaf: htk4_8458

Meeting notes — 3 Mar, Ops sync, Harwick site launch. Present: J. Mellor, R. Asquith, D. Penn. Key-card stock for the new Harwick site confirmed short: 40 blanks on hand, 220 needed. Order placed with Corvane Systems; blanks arrive Thursday at the Dunmere warehouse. Shift lead to count and cage them on arrival — no open shelving. Encoding happens at Harwick, not here. Courier from Ashfell Secure collects Friday 08:30, dock two. Action: shift lead meets the courier personally and relays this instruction at hand-over:

dispatch memo: the lamwyn fenwyn courier leaves the wenir ledger at gate 7175 under passcode 822969

Handover Note — Customer Support Outsourcing

From the outgoing to the incoming Director of Operations, Quarrow Technologies, for circulation to sales leads. The plan to outsource tier-one support to the Bellamine service group is at contract stage. Transition begins next quarter; in-house staff move to escalations only. Sales leads should avoid committing to custom support terms until the cutover completes. Expect a client FAQ shortly. Please review the confidential note appended below before client conversations.

board note of tadup-tajog: Headcount on the Oliiel team goes from 31 to 88 by the end of February. Gross margin on Oliiel came in at 62 percent against a plan of 29 percent.